The ICD/ITKE 2014 research pavilion had its opening earlier this spring in Stuttgart, Germany.
Courtesy of © ICD-ITKE
The project is a collaboration of students and Prof. Achim Menges from the ICD Institute of Computational Design, and Prof. Jan Knippers from ITKE Institute of Building Structures and Structural Design.
Courtesy of © ICD-ITKE
The structure was robotically fabricated from 35 fiber composite components, the biggest being 2.6m in diameter with a weight of 24.1kg.
